The Guinea Energy and Environment Conference & Exhibition (SEEG) is organised by AME Trade & Rarili with the support of the Ministry of Energy and the Ministry of Environment and Sustainable Development of the Republic of Guinea. It is the premier platform for investment, deal-making, and strategic dialogue on Guinea’s sustainable energy and environmental future, bringing together heads of government, energy and environment ministers, development finance institutions, global investors, technology companies, conservation organisations, and project developers.

The Republic of Guinea stands at a historic inflection point. Blessed with one of Africa’s most abundant concentrations of natural resources — from world-class hydropower to vast bauxite and iron ore deposits, and a growing hydrocarbon frontier — Guinea is rapidly transforming into a continental energy powerhouse. Against the backdrop of the landmark Simandou 2040 national development programme, an incoming wave of hydropower capacity, ambitious solar expansion, and a frontier oil & gas licensing round, the timing could not be more compelling.
